Why Choose Local Door and Window Suppliers?
When browsing for services and products, homeowners often dispute between big national chains and local companies. Going with regional service providers features a number of distinct benefits:
- Regional Expertise: Local providers understand the particular environment difficulties of the area-- whether it is extreme summer season heat, freezing winters, high humidity, or coastal salt air. They stock items engineered to hold up against regional weather patterns.
- Faster Turnaround Times: Proximity equates to quicker shipment times, much easier scheduling for measurements and installations, and faster response rates if maintenance or modifications are required later.
- Customized Customer Service: Local companies greatly count on community reputation. They tend to provide tailored consultations, devoted job managers, and a greater level of individualized attention compared to huge corporate call centers.
- Easier Warranty Claims: Dealing with a regional storefront or professional makes guarantee service, repairs, and part replacements a lot more simple.
Understanding Your Options: Materials and Styles
Before getting in touch with local professionals, it helps to understand the kinds of windows and doors available on the marketplace. Different materials suit various budget plans, aesthetic choices, and upkeep capacities.
Window Material Comparison
| Material | Pros | Cons | Best For |
|---|---|---|---|
| Vinyl | Budget-friendly, energy-efficient, low upkeep, does not rot or peel. | Limited color alternatives, can warp under severe heat if low quality. | Budget-conscious house owners wanting sturdiness. |
| Wood | Traditional aesthetic, exceptional natural insulation, extremely personalized. | High upkeep, vulnerable to moisture damage, costly. | Historic homes and traditional architectural designs. |
| Aluminum | Slim profiles, light-weight, exceptionally strong, modern-day appearance. | Poor natural insulator (unless thermally broken), vulnerable to condensation. | Modern styles and warm environments. |
| Fiberglass | Exceptionally long lasting, expands/contracts really little, mimics wood grain. | Greater upfront expense, professional installation needed. | All environments, especially areas with severe temperature swings. |
Popular Door Styles to Consider
- Entry Doors: The focal point of the home's facade. Offered in fiberglass, steel, and wood.
- Outdoor patio doors windows near me: Options consist of sliding glass window door doors, traditional French doors, and modern-day folding/bi-fold doors that flawlessly connect indoor and outside living areas.
- Interior Doors: Hollow-core for affordable spaces or solid-core for better soundproofing and personal privacy.
Step-by-Step: How to Find and Evaluate Local Installers
Typing "windows and doors near me" into a search bar will yield dozens of results. To narrow down the list to the most dependable specialists, follow this detailed evaluation procedure:
- Check Licensing and Insurance: Ensure the contractor holds a legitimate state or regional license and carries both liability insurance and workers' settlement. This safeguards the property owner from liability in case of mishaps on the home.
- Validate Certifications: Look for installers accredited by trustworthy market companies, such as the Fenestration and Glazing Industry Alliance (FGIA) or specific producer accreditations (e.g., Pella Certified Contractor, Andersen Certified).
- Read Local Reviews: Check platforms like Google, Yelp, and the Better Business Bureau (BBB). Take notice of how business manage unfavorable reviews-- this often reveals their true dedication to client complete satisfaction.
- Demand Multiple Quotes: Never choose the very first price quote. Get at least three detailed, composed quotes that break down the cost of materials, labor, disposal of old units, and permits.
- Inquire About Warranties: A respectable regional installer will provide a workmanship guarantee (usually ranging from 1 to 10 years) in addition to the producer's warranty on the actual windows and windows.and doors near me.
Warning to Watch Out For
While a lot of regional professionals run with stability, the home improvement market does attract dishonest operators. Keep an eye out for these indication:
- High-Pressure Sales Tactics: Pressuring house owners to sign an agreement on the area by offering a "one-time-only" discount rate.
- Cash-Only Payments: Legitimate services accept checks and charge card. Demanding cash upfront is a significant warning.
- Unclear Estimates: If the quote does not have specific details about trademark name, model numbers, and scope of work, keep looking.
- No Physical Address: Be cautious of professionals who only run out of a P.O. Box or an unmarked truck with no verifiable regional storefront.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. Just how much do new doors and windows cost?
The expense differs significantly based on products, size, labor, and the number of systems being changed. Usually, window & door replacements can vary from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,000+ per window set up. Entry doors usually range from ₤ 1,000 to ₤ 4,000+ including installation. Always get several localized quotes for an accurate price quote.
2. How long does the installation procedure take?
For a basic property home (approximately 10-- 15 windows), expert setup typically takes between 1 to 3 days. Big patio area doors or custom-made architectural windows may require more time.
3. Can I set up doors and windows myself?
While DIY setup is possible for experienced handymen, it is generally discouraged for main outside doors and windows. Incorrect setup can cause air leaks, water infiltration, structural damage, and the voiding of producer service warranties. Professional installation ensures airtight seals and optimum energy effectiveness.
4. How do I know when it is time to replace my windows?
Secret indications include noticeable drafts, condensation between glass window door panes (showing a failed seal), problem opening or closing, rotting frames, and significantly greater energy expenses.
